Recent forecasts for London on September 2 indicate overnight lows likely ranging from 12–15°C under mostly cloudy skies and southwesterly flow, with Met Office guidance showing temperatures near or slightly above seasonal norms amid an unsettled pattern. Model outputs highlight modest radiative cooling limited by high humidity and cloud cover, alongside mild Atlantic advection that reduces the potential for sharper drops below 13°C. Trader sentiment clusters around 15–20°C thresholds because urban heat-island effects and forecast spread create genuine uncertainty about whether the minimum will settle near 14°C or hold above 18°C. Updated runs from the Met Office and ECMWF over the next 48 hours will likely refine these probabilities ahead of resolution.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the lowest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=eglc
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event which there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
